S 3336, “SENATE RESOLUTION URGING THE UNITED STATES CONGRESS TO ENACT TECHNICAL AMENDMENTS TO THE CAMP LEJEUNE JUSTICE ACT OF 2022”, was introduced in the Senate on May 29, 2026 by Sen. Walter Felag (D) with 1 co-sponsor. It last saw action on Jun 2, 2026: Senate read and passed.

SENATE RESOLUTION
URGING THE UNITED STATES CONGRESS TO ENACT TECHNICAL AMENDMENTS
TO THE CAMP LEJEUNE JUSTICE ACT OF 2022
Introduced By: Senators Felag, and Valverde
Date Introduced: May 29, 2026
Referred To: Placed on the Senate Consent Calendar
WHEREAS, The Senate hereby recognizes the service and sacrifice of the men and
women of the United States Armed Forces and their families; and
WHEREAS, From 1953 through 1987, individuals stationed at or residing on Marine
Corps Base Camp Lejeune were exposed to drinking water contaminated with hazardous
chemicals, resulting in significant adverse health effects, including cancers, neurological
disorders, and other serious illnesses; and
WHEREAS, In response to this injustice, the Congress of the United States enacted the
Camp Lejeune Justice Act of 2022 as part of the Honoring our PACT Act of 2022, thereby
creating a cause of action to allow affected individuals to seek appropriate relief for injuries and
wrongful death; and
WHEREAS, Since its enactment, hundreds of thousands of claims have been filed,
revealing significant administrative and judicial challenges, including delays in claim processing,
uncertainty in applicable legal standards, and barriers to timely resolution; and
WHEREAS, Technical amendments to the Camp Lejeune Justice Act have been
proposed in the Congress of the United States, including the Ensuring Justice for Camp Lejeune
Victims Act, to clarify evidentiary standards, improve efficiency in adjudication, and ensure that
claimants receive fair and timely consideration of their claims; and
WHEREAS, It is in the interest of justice and fairness that Congress act promptly to
address these issues and fulfill the original intent of providing meaningful relief to those harmed
by toxic exposure at Camp Lejeune; now, therefore be it
RESOLVED, That this Senate of the State of Rhode Island hereby urges the Congress of
the United States to enact legislation to make necessary technical amendments to the Camp
Lejeune Justice Act of 2022 in order to ensure the efficient, fair, and expeditious resolution of
claims; and be it further
RESOLVED, That the Secretary of State be and hereby is authorized and directed to
transmit duly certified copies of this resolution to the President of the United States, the Speaker
of the United States House of Representatives, the Majority Leader of the United States Senate,
and to each member of the Rhode Island Congressional delegation.
